There is a well-known
correspondence in Yoga practice of the proposed Chakra locations in the
Astral Form with the literal locations of the endocrine glands in
the Physical Form – i.e. the physical body. Briefly, these are:
Sahasrara – The
pituitary gland, the master gland that secretes the hormones
that control the balance of
the ductless (endocrine) gland system. Also connects to the central
nervous system via the hypothalamus and thalamus. The thalamus is thought
to have a key role in the physical basis of consciousness.
Ajna – The
pineal gland, a light sensitive gland that regulates the
human sleep response. There is some
difference of opinion among authorities regarding whether Sahasrara and
Ajna correspond to the pituitary and pineal glands or whether the correspondence is, in fact, reversed.
Vishuddha – The thyroid
gland, controls growth and maturation.
Anahata – The thymus gland, located very near the heart in the
chest cavity, and responsible
for the immune system and T-cell production. This gland is known to be adversely effected by stress.
Manipura – The adrenal glands, responsible for the
release of adrenalin, the natural
organismic amphetamine that enables heightened response to emergency situations, and helps to regulate digestion under more normal conditions.
Svadhisthana – Related to the testes in men, and
the ovaries in women and the corresponding release of testosterone and estrogen into the biological
system of the respective sexes. Presumed in Kundalini Yoga to be the
site of the divergence of Kundalini Tantra into the Right (ascension) and
Left (sexual) Hand Paths.
Muladhara – No specific glandular
association, but presumed to be secondarily associated with the prostate in men (and the ability to
sustain male sexual arousal and erection), and menstruation in
women.
